ACC ACC plans to take over a 5.5MW solar farm, valued at Bt320mn. It expects this to contribute Bt33mn net profit/year. It plans to issue warrants at a ratio of 4 shares per warrant. BWG BWG has strong fundamentals, high retained earnings and no debt with D/E at 0.62X. It expects profit growth of over 30% in 2015 supported by expanding its customer base. AMATA Vietnam government has approved AMATA investment in Amata City Long Thanh, valued at US$258mn. It expects this to open in 2017 and attract US$500mn in foreign investment intially. AP AP expects 2015 net profit to mark a record high of Bt25.3bn. It targets presales of Bt28.3bn and already has Bt18bn. It expects to launch 15 new projects throughout the rest of the year, worth Bt24bn.
